We report on a c.w. two-beam experiment unambiguously evidencing the polariton transfer from initial states to final states which takes place through a stimulated scattering process. One beam is nonresonant while the other resonantly creates a large occupation factor in the lower polariton final state. Gain, resulting in a deepening of the lower polariton reflectivity dip, is observed on the resonant beam. Simultaneously, the luminescence of large in-plane wave-vector states decreases linearly with the resonant power.
